Stupid Dropbox tricks
Remember a while back when I was asking for tips on using Dropbox? I found one recently, almost by accident. It turns out, if you have a Dropbox account and the iPhone app installed, if you click a download link in Mobile Safari, instead of doing nothing, you get a screen asking if you’d like to open your Dropbox app and save it there, instead.
